Web• EH-resistance means your boots can deal with 18,000 volts at 60 hertz for 60 seconds in dry conditions provided there’s no current flow or leakage above 1 milliampere. The safety toe material has nothing to do with the Electrical Hazard (EH) properties of a safety shoe.
